Hi guys, I am afraid of a security issue with Docker. Sorry but I have no other machines to test for now, so it might be a local issue only. I realized that today when running an Ubuntu container : % docker run -ti --rm --hostname=ubuntu --net=host ubuntu /bin/bash It runs a bash shell inside the Ubuntu container. But, from within the container (screenshot attached): % apt update # should fail, not finding the command % zypper refresh # unexpectedly, it would work and refresh the host repos! Of course, this is absolutely abnormal and I am still evaluating the exact impact. I can tell that the issue was not here one week ago (I have been a quite intensive Docker user for around 2 years).
